Astrobiological tourism encourages adventurers to engage with environments that simulate extraterrestrial landscapes. From the bubbling geothermal pools of Iceland, reminiscent of an otherworldly terrain, to the stark, desert vistas of Chile’s Atacama—one of the driest places on Earth—travelers are invited to experience locations that mirror the elusive habitats of our solar system. Each destination provides a unique perspective on the conditions that could foster extraterrestrial life, igniting the imagination and curiosity of all who venture forth.
A pivotal element of this burgeoning sector is the educational dimension it encompasses. Many tours and excursions are designed to enlighten participants about the scientific principles guiding modern astrobiology. Through engaging presentations by leading researchers and interactive workshops, travelers are not just passive observers; they become active participants in the exploration of life’s possibilities beyond our pale blue dot. Such experiences often include visits to observatories, laboratories, and esteemed research institutions that focus on astrobiological phenomena. Those fascinated by the potential for life on other planets can delve deeper into topics such as extremophiles—organisms that thrive in the most inhospitable environments on Earth—providing insight into the resilience of life itself.

While astrobiological tourism is an intriguing prospect, ethical considerations must remain at the forefront of its development. As travelers traverse these fragile ecosystems, it is imperative to minimize impact and respect the natural and cultural heritage of the areas visited. The intersection of tourism and environmental stewardship can ensure that these extraordinary locations remain pristine and can serve as research sites for future generations. A responsible approach to astrobiological tourism emphasizes the importance of preserving our planet’s natural wonders—which are, after all, the only examples we currently have of life in the universe.
